Open Doors is the key publication with comprehensive accurate information on the international students in the United States and on U.S. students who sojourn abroad as part of their academic experience. The book provides 96 pages of data on national origin, sources of financial support, fields of study, host institutions, academic level, and rates of growth of the international student population in the United States, as well as the economic impact of foreign students to the host state and national economies. Open Doors makes extensive use of graphics to highlight key facts and trends. Also included in the publication are: sections on Foreign Scholars in the U.S., Intensive English Programs, and U.S. study abroad.
